From 6f4e595e9ba9d7ac79873a1dc0a98144e6f136cb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Philipp Oeser Date: Tue, 20 Aug 2019 11:57:30 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Fix T68852: Link select crashes after knife project Knife project switches out of vertex selection mode, but wouldnt do this for all participating meshes. Logic in edbm_select_linked_pick would switch the viewcontext multiple times and the meshes selectmode was not in sync then, leading e.g. finding a vertex in 'unified_findnearest' (because last of the meshes selectmode was SCE_SELECT_VERTEX), but then later in 'EDBM_elem_from_selectmode' other meshes selectmode was not matching SCE_SELECT_VERTEX, leading to crash...
